    Does my husband a permanent U.S. resident have to pay tax on money from his dead mom
    My husband, a permanent U.S. resident inherited his mother's house and some land in Iran . It has just been settled and he is entitled to 50k. When he gets this does he have to pay taxes on it.

    There is no US federal inheritance tax. However, there are a few states that impose an inheritance tax on their residents - tell us what state he lives in and we can check it out. I can't speak to whether he owes and taxes to Iran.

    Virginia is the state we live in. Won't we be questioned on the sudden appearance of money in our accounts? And do we declare it as income.

    VA does not have an inheritance tax, so no worries on that score.

    He may have to file Form 3520 to declare the international wire transfer. There is no tax associated with this- just needs to be declared. See: http://www.irs.gov/pub/irs-pdf/i3520.pdf
